For Chinese New Year 2019, Hennessy collaborated with emerging Chinese artist Guangyu Zhang in an artistic collaboration to reimagine the Hennessy V.S.O.P Privilege design as a limited edition. Through a contemporary visual story, the edition captured the spirit of renewal celebrated during the Lunar New Year, while reinforcing Hennessy’s heritage and craftsmanship for key audiences in China.
In this creative dialogue, Zhang beautifully bridges Eastern heritage and Western craftsmanship, embodying Hennessy’s enduring spirit of artistry and cultural connection. This limited edition translates this exchange into a refined design expression, staying true to the Maison’s identity while connecting to the festive energy of the Lunar New Year.
Inspired by the Year of the Pig, the artwork reflects the cyclical rhythm of life through a layered digital collage. Symbols of heaven and earth, past and present create a sense of balance and harmony. At its centre, interlocking circles evoke completion and fulfillment, while subtly echoing Hennessy’s signature double distillation. Through geometry, blur, layering, and contrast, Zhang builds a rich visual language that expresses cultural fusion and the precision of Hennessy’s craftsmanship.
The launch was supported by limited-edition Hennessy V.S.O.P Privilege bottles and a premium presentation box, revealed through festive key visuals. The activation then expanded across digital touchpoints with an artist video and 3D animation, bringing the artwork to life throughout the Lunar New Year campaign in key Chinese markets. In parallel, an immersive pop-up experience translated the visual story into a physical setting through curated displays and interactive content, showcasing Zhang Guangyu’s artistic vision and reinforcing Hennessy’s heritage
Guangyu Zhang is a Chinese digital artist who has collaborated with global brands such as Hennessy and Carlsberg. After graduating from Central Saint Martins with a Bachelor of Fine Arts, he began his career exploring traditional Chinese ink textures and color systems through digital art and experimental printing techniques. He produces limited-edition pigment prints on fine art paper.
Today, his practice has expanded to include large-scale oil and acrylic paintings, as well as 3D animations that extend his visual universe into immersive digital forms. Guangyu Zhang’s work blends traditional Chinese ink painting with contemporary pop culture, disrupting classical aesthetics through the integration of architectural elements, anachronistic objects, and surreal compositions. His practice creates a dialogue between heritage and modernity, offering visually striking narratives that resonate strongly with contemporary audiences and forward-thinking brands.
